Transaction aef7793fe146ad8412d97f4072627c5d980498554ee873a8070f0c7700117b03
1 Input
2 Outputs
- aef7793fe146ad8412d97f4072627c5d980498554ee873a8070f0c7700117b03:0
- aef7793fe146ad8412d97f4072627c5d980498554ee873a8070f0c7700117b03:1
value 572011
address 16DcAr6ERHcWXePxzgsjQKg452m4D4DD4i
value 1915074
address 167ZHu83rMHJxZ8pfVN2ezU4qeHLh1sEPX